Output 6213ebc39e407ab70f5fa0598689417442681b7f0137f1ed1935e9663ed44637:0

value
6144525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b184fcd4b1f788a682534a44e328f2a3c70ecdd OP_EQUAL
address
3QageuF3siuRqzrsb7wq9eLtMrtzwHspDZ
transaction
6213ebc39e407ab70f5fa0598689417442681b7f0137f1ed1935e9663ed44637
confirmations
395462
spent
true